Udemy
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
Development
Web Development Data Science Mobile Development Programming Languages Game Development Database Design & Development Software Testing Software Engineering Development Tools No-Code Development
Business
Entrepreneurship Communications Management Sales Business Strategy Operations Project Management Business Law Business Analytics & Intelligence Human Resources Industry E-Commerce Media Real Estate Other Business
Finance & Accounting
Accounting & Bookkeeping Compliance Cryptocurrency & Blockchain Economics Finance Finance Cert & Exam Prep Financial Modeling & Analysis Investing & Trading Money Management Tools Taxes Other Finance & Accounting
IT & Software
IT Certification Network & Security Hardware Operating Systems Other IT & Software
Office Productivity
Microsoft Apple Google SAP Oracle Other Office Productivity
Personal Development
Personal Transformation Personal Productivity Leadership Career Development Parenting & Relationships Happiness Esoteric Practices Religion & Spirituality Personal Brand Building Creativity Influence Self Esteem & Confidence Stress Management Memory & Study Skills Motivation Other Personal Development
Design
Web Design Graphic Design & Illustration Design Tools User Experience Design Game Design Design Thinking 3D & Animation Fashion Design Architectural Design Interior Design Other Design
Marketing
Digital Marketing Search Engine Optimization Social Media Marketing Branding Marketing Fundamentals Marketing Analytics & Automation Public Relations Advertising Video & Mobile Marketing Content Marketing Growth Hacking Affiliate Marketing Product Marketing Other Marketing
Lifestyle
Arts & Crafts Beauty & Makeup Esoteric Practices Food & Beverage Gaming Home Improvement Pet Care & Training Travel Other Lifestyle
Photography & Video
Digital Photography Photography Portrait Photography Photography Tools Commercial Photography Video Design Other Photography & Video
Health & Fitness
Fitness General Health Sports Nutrition Yoga Mental Health Dieting Self Defense Safety & First Aid Dance Meditation Other Health & Fitness
Music
Instruments Music Production Music Fundamentals Vocal Music Techniques Music Software Other Music
Teaching & Academics
Engineering Humanities Math Science Online Education Social Science Language Teacher Training Test Prep Other Teaching & Academics
AWS Certification Microsoft Certification AWS Certified Solutions Architect - Associate AWS Certified Cloud Practitioner CompTIA A+ Cisco CCNA Amazon AWS CompTIA Security+ AWS Certified Developer - Associate
Photoshop Graphic Design Adobe Illustrator Drawing Digital Painting InDesign Character Design Canva Figure Drawing
Life Coach Training Neuro-Linguistic Programming Mindfulness Personal Development Meditation Personal Transformation Life Purpose Emotional Intelligence CBT
Web Development JavaScript React CSS Angular PHP WordPress Node.Js Python
Digital Marketing Google Ads (Adwords) Social Media Marketing Google Ads (AdWords) Certification Marketing Strategy Internet Marketing YouTube Marketing Email Marketing Retargeting
SQL Microsoft Power BI Tableau Business Analysis Business Intelligence MySQL Data Analysis Data Modeling Data Science
Business Fundamentals Entrepreneurship Fundamentals Business Strategy Online Business Business Plan Startup Freelancing Blogging Home Business
Unity Game Development Fundamentals Unreal Engine C# 3D Game Development C++ 2D Game Development Unreal Engine Blueprints Blender
30-Day Money-Back Guarantee
Development Mobile Development Android Development

Curso Completo de Android Material Design

Crie interfaces lindas e sensacionais com o Android Material Design e eleve suas habilidades em desenvolvimento Android.
Highest Rated
Rating: 4.5 out of 54.5 (1,021 ratings)
5,903 students
Created by AndroidPro Blog
Last updated 5/2020
Portuguese
30-Day Money-Back Guarantee

What you'll learn

  • Crie aplicativos sensacionais com o Android Material Design de forma eficaz
  • Saber como usar todos os recursos do Material Design no desenvolvimento Android
  • Tornar-se um profissional em desenvolvimento Android mais qualificado

Course content

18 sections • 88 lectures • 7h 19m total length

  • Preview02:39
  • Material Design é 3D
    03:30
  • As Propriedades
    04:33
  • Elevação & Sombras
    06:40
  • As Cores
    04:28
  • Ícones & Imagens
    05:19
  • Tipografia
    04:54

  • Introdução (Como funciona o papel)
    02:48
  • Unidades & Medidas
    06:05
  • Métricas & Keylines
    06:36
  • Preview08:34
  • Design Responsivo
    08:48

  • Introdução
    04:32
  • Como funciona o Tema
    05:19
  • Definindo e Selecionando as Cores
    08:28
  • Mantendo a Compatibilidade
    05:53

  • Introdução
    01:49
  • Adicionando o AppCompat EditText
    06:22
  • Adicionando o Text Input Layout
    05:47
  • Validando os campos
    07:26
  • Adicionando Contador e Mostrar Senha
    03:23

  • Introdução
    02:41
  • Criando um Botão Elevado
    06:09
  • Criando um Flat Button
    03:17
  • Criando um Floating Action Button
    06:09

  • Introdução
    01:28
  • Configurando a Toolbar
    05:59
  • Adicionando o Menu
    05:41
  • Adicionando Click no Menu
    02:52
  • Customizando a Toolbar e Menu
    07:10

  • Introdução
    02:22
  • Criando o Layout da Navigatio
    07:54
  • Criando o Header da Navigation Drawer
    07:48
  • Adicionando o Menu na Navigation Drawer
    08:11
  • Preview06:21
  • Implementando Click no Menu
    04:41

  • Introdução
    01:34
  • Criando um Switch
    05:08
  • Criando um Checkbox
    03:48
  • Criando RadioButton e RadioGroup
    07:27

  • Introdução
    02:23
  • Criando uma Alert Dialog
    09:41
  • Criando Dialogs com Opções
    11:20

  • Introdução
    02:08
  • Criando uma Snackbar
    07:28
  • Adicionando CoordinatorLayout e Botão
    04:22
  • Customizando a Snackbar
    03:05
  • Entendendo o Toast
    02:34

Requirements

  • Conhecimento básico da linguagem de programação Java
  • Android Studio instalado no seu computador
  • Saber como executar aplicativos Android no emulador ou no seu dispositivo Android
  • Paixão em desenvolver aplicativos Android

Description

*** Depoimentos de nossos Alunos sobre o Curso Completo de Android Material Design ***

"Muito bom! Eu estava esperando um curso assim, reunindo a documentação do Material Design e explicando seus detalhes. Aprovadíssimo! Obrigado Fillipe e time do AndroidPro!"
- Pablo Paschoaletto

"Mesmo cursando o Android Acellerate, eu não sabia que podia adicionar tantos recursos no design dos meus Apps! Estou aprendendo MUITO!"
- Alfredo Vieira Neto

"Muito bom o curso. Excelente didática."
- Celina Ferreira Ribeiro

*** 100% Baseado na Especificação do Android Material Design do Google ***

Um curso completo 100% baseado na especificação de Android Material Design do Google dividido em aulas conceituais e práticas, para você se tornar um expert no assunto em apenas 2 semanas e elevar seus conhecimentos em desenvolvimento Android!

O que é Android Material Design?

Com o lançamento do Android Lollipop, o Material Design do Google começou a ser usado pelos melhores profissionais no desenvolvimento Android. Designers e desenvolvedores em todos os lugares estão entusiasmados com a nova linguagem de design que visa unir a grande linha de produtos do Google sob um rico conjunto de estilos e princípios de design.

Você quer criar aplicativos Android bonitos e sensacionais?

E você quer desenvolve-los o mais suave possível, sem ter que ler inúmeros livros ou tutoriais pela Internet sobre desenvolvimento Android e Material Design?

E claro: você só quer a mais recente tecnologia, software e técnicas - porque você tem grandes planos, grandes idéias - e vamos ser honestos, você é impaciente e quer ir mais rápido?

Todos os conceitos do Android Material Design você pode encontrar aqui. Este curso é baseado em projetos, o que significa que você vai aprender criando aplicativos surpreendentes!

Neste curso, você vai aprender tudo sobre Material Design para desenvolvimento Android!. No final deste curso, você poderá desenvolver seus próprios aplicativos Android a partir do zero, implementando a Especificação do Android Material Design.

Por que utilizar o Material Design no desenvolvimento Android?

Com milhões de aplicativos Android já publicados no Google Play Store, seus aplicativos devem ser surpreendentes e bonitos, de modo que ele tenha maior chance de ser considerado um aplicativo top. É por isso que este curso, é projetado especificamente para ensinar você as regras do Android Material Design no e como implementá-las para elevar seu nível no desenvolvimento Android.

*** Conteúdos Novos Toda Semana e Promoções Todo Mês ***

Além de garantir um curso incrível, você receberá semanalmente novos conteúdos sobre desenvolvimento Android profissional por email e via anúncios na plataforma da Udemy.

E também, todo mês fazemos promoções especiais de cursos para nossos alunos, além de receber acesso antecipado a novos cursos por um preço totalmente especial.

Who this course is for:

  • Se você quer desenvolver aplicativos Android que use Material Design
  • Se você quer criar seus próprios aplicativos Android com Material Design
  • Se você quer um emprego como desenvolvedor Android
  • Se você quer criar incríveis aplicativos Android com o Material Design apenas por diversão
  • Se você quer trabalhar como freelancer usando o Android Material Design
  • Qualquer um que queira dominar o Android Material Design
  • Se você quer elevar seus conhecimentos em desenvolvimento Android

Instructor

AndroidPro Blog
Torne-se Desenvolvedor Android Profissional e Independente
AndroidPro Blog
  • 4.5 Instructor Rating
  • 1,581 Reviews
  • 8,057 Students
  • 2 Courses

Como sabemos, já é possível fazer quase de tudo com alguns toques na tela de pequenos dispositivos que temos à palma da mão, seja para a comunicação, trabalho, localização ou solicitações de serviços. Os benefícios dos aplicativos vão além da praticidade, pois muitos aplicativos colaboram, inclusive, com  a saúde, com a educação e com a mobilidade urbana das grandes cidades.

A tecnologia está nos permitindo repensar e replanejar grande parte de nossa vida. Ações muito além do consumo. A internet das coisas está presente no nosso dia a dia, em carros, TV, eletrodomésticos, relógios, roupas… atualmente tudo está sendo conectado a internet. E o objetivo de todas essas ações, revoluções e evoluções é único: tornar a nossa vida mais prática.

No início de 2015, foi contabilizado mais de 1,43 milhão de aplicativos disponíveis no mercado, e mais dois bilhões de pessoas usando aplicativos todos os dias. Dentre esses “pequenos” números, o Android é o sistema operacional mais utilizado em portáteis, com mais de 1 bilhão de aparelhos ativos até o começo do ano (imagina agora!).

Ainda assim, com todos esses números e os bilhões de dólares que giram no mercado mobile, a demanda por bons profissionais da área ainda supera a oferta destes. Desenvolvimento mobile, antes considerada a carreira do futuro, já faz parte do presente há algum tempo, e os profissionais que investirem em especialização, com certeza conseguirão o seu “lugar ao sol”.

Inclusive, foi assim que aconteceu comigo, que, sendo “Javeiro” e enxergando grandes oportunidades de crescimento no mercado mobile, decidi aprender Android e abraçar essa área pela qual me apaixonei, e que me trouxe tantas oportunidades, ganhos profissionais e pessoais também.

Nesses anos de experiência, fiz aplicativos para grandes e pequenas empresas brasileiras e internacionais, destacando-se entre estes, aplicativos para Itaú, Trikae, Kanui, Renovei e Dafiti. Aprendi muito sobre a área e suas oportunidades, e decidi montar o AndroidPro para ajudar àqueles que se interessam por desenvolvimento de aplicativos Android.

No meio da minha “peregrinação” rumo a me tornar um desenvolvedor Android profissional, eu estabeleci um método de aprendizado, compilando todos os cursos, livros e materiais gratuitos que eu havia consumido ao longo daqueles meses, e dividi toda essa informação em 04 elementos principais:

  1. Conceitos Básicos
  2. Interface Gráfica
  3. Manipulação de Dados
  4. Ferramentas

Estabelecer esse método para mim mesmo, me ajudou muito a aprender Android e colocar em prática meu aprendizado. Fiz vários cursos (sempre um para complementar o outro), li ainda mais e busquei vencer as dificuldades que tinha em entender como a linguagem Java era aplicada em Android (essa informação era bem difícil de encontrar).

Me apaixonei por tudo o que a plataforma oferecia e pretendia oferecer e mergulhei cada vez mais no Android, que, além de trabalho, se tornou um hobby.

Muita leitura, prática e aplicativos depois, percebi a carência que ainda temos de conteúdos de qualidade, que ensinam como desenvolver Android. Por isso, decidi criar o AndroidPro com o objetivo primário de dividir meu conhecimento e ensinar à quem é entusiasta e quer entrar na área, um caminho mais prático para aprender sobre desenvolvimento Android.

Para saber mais sobre os Conceitos Básicos, Interface Gráfica do Android, Manipulação de Dados, Ferramentas e Carreira Android, basta cadastrar seu e-mail para receber nossos conteúdos em primeira mão.

  • Udemy for Business
  • Teach on Udemy
  • Get the app
  • About us
  • Contact us
  • Careers
  • Blog
  • Help and Support
  • Affiliate
  • Terms
  • Privacy policy
  • Cookie settings
  • Sitemap
  • Featured courses
Udemy
© 2021 Udemy, Inc.